"This is a characterful property set overlooking lovely views of the river Sile and apart from occasional traffic noise is very peaceful. We found the staff very welcoming. Although registration is not until after 15.00 we were able to leave our bags in Reception when we arrived earlier so we could explore the town and find somewhere for lunch. The entrance is by a buzzer on a door at the side of the building just beyond the cafè and once you are buzzed inside the accommodation is on the third floor. Our room was in the front left corner with lovely views over the river and was very spacious. Everything was clean and tidy and a kettle and selection of teas is provided. There is a slope on the floor which was not a problem but watch the little step into the bathroom at night! The twin beds were very comfortable and quilts are provided for added warmth which we found very useful. Altogether a charming place to stay the night and highly recommended. "

"Pros. Good location, excellent apartment, good facilities, easy access to train station and Venice, lots of eating options, supermarket next door, plus a large Pam supermarket 5 mins. Very walkable locally.
Cons. In a little alleyway, could do with better instructions for finding it. Up two flights of stairs, could be a problem for people with mobility problems. Quite noisy due to central location. Rubbish collections daily and so noisy from bin wagon during night. Putting different rubbish bins out daily means taking them up and down two flights of stairs. No instructions for washing machine. Using grill and kettle at same time tripped the circuit breaker by front street door. Easily reset if you know how, which we did. All in all a really good well equipped apartment and very reasonably priced."
